The School of Film and Media Studies Welcomes Film Editor Andrew Buckland ’94
Time: 7:00pmAndrew Buckland ’94 (Film) returns to campus to share insight on his career that took him from working as an apprentice editor fresh out of film school to winning an Academy Award for Ford V. Ferrari in 2019.
A reel of career highlights will be screened, interspersed with opportunities for audience members to ask questions and dialogue with him.
